sql >> Databasteknik >  >> RDS >> PostgreSQL

Kan inte ansluta till PostgreSQL på distans på Amazon EC2-instans med PgAdmin

Jag hittade lösningen på det här problemet. Två saker krävs.

  1. Använd en textredigerare för att ändra pg_hba.conf. Leta reda på linjen:

    host all all 127.0.0.1/0 md5.

    Omedelbart under den, lägg till den här nya raden:

    host all all 0.0.0.0/0 md5

  2. Redigera PostgreSQL postgresql.conf-filen:

    Använd en textredigerare för att ändra postgresql.conf.

    Leta reda på raden som börjar med #listen_addresses = 'localhost' .

    Avkommentera raden genom att ta bort # , och ändra 'localhost' till '*' .

    Raden ska nu se ut så här:

    listen_addresses = '*' # what IP address(es) to listen on;.

Nu är det bara att starta om din postgres-tjänst så kommer den att kunna ansluta



  1. NLS_CHARSET_NAME() Funktion i Oracle

  2. Hur man beräknar procent i PostgreSQL

  3. Hur fungerar SQL Server Wildcard Character Range, t.ex. [A-D], med skiftlägeskänslig sortering?

  4. Flytta data från gammal tabell till en annan tabell PHP MYSQL